Output 32b5c35db7bb94b5f98f0525eba363bfe2d4e388f12c88e4ff123de24b013139:23

value
19556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b1f8f245c3e96e38d9c7d3f3d6b0ca68db3818 OP_EQUAL
address
3LMLyRHcXJNpPcRZ8qGDY1WX1j5nUoioGa
transaction
32b5c35db7bb94b5f98f0525eba363bfe2d4e388f12c88e4ff123de24b013139
spent
true